The next biennial Philanthropy Australia Conference will be held at Dockside Conference Centre, Cockle Bay Wharf, Sydney, on Tuesday 4 September and Wednesday 5 September 2012.
» Register online now
The conference theme is Making Philanthropy Our Business, with keynote speakers as well as four concurrent themes on:
- Emerging Issues in Philanthropy (e.g. in the areas of governance, investment / financial policies, grantmaking, regulation);
- Social Investment (e.g. new ways of financing, investment with financial returns, applicability of business principles);
- Towards Positive Outcomes (e.g. social media, overcoming barriers, education);
- Effective Practice in Grantmaking (e.g. models of innovative practice, sharing effective practice, measuring impact, advocacy, partnerships, collaboration, benchmarking).
